Marvin Humphrey, a fireman, his sister, police rank Rochelle Humphrey and 25-year-old taxi driver, Cecil Davis, were yesterday charged with two counts of robbery under arms and simple larceny.
It was alleged that on February 5 at Land of Canaan, while being armed with a gun they robbed Hilton Baptiste of $75,000.
It was also alleged that they robbed Rauldon Benjamin of a quantity of alcohol and $20,260 cash, all worth $37,260.
In addition, they were charged with stealing a quantity of jewellery from Valerie Gordon. Marvin Humphrey, 25, of Lot 1 Samaroo Dam, West Bank Demerara; police constable Rochelle Humphrey, 23, of the same address, and Davis, 25, of 818 Bell West Bank Demerara all pleaded not guilty.
Police Prosecutor, Denise Griffith, asked that bail be refused. She added that the defendants also went on a rampage in Berbice and similar charges arose from that.
Bail was refused and the matter was transferred to Providence Magistrate’s Court.
